I suggest you forget that idea. JAC will charge you either by weight or by volume (this is the same way that they are charged by the airlines). If the item is bulky (such as in the case of a chair), you will be charged by volume and it will be a lot.

For my experience of 10 movies & above in a single box...total weight is btw 3-4 lb.   

My advice: It's better to combine & group all your purchases into one box or as few as possible ("average cost per unit" law). If you order 10 movies in 10 separate boxes, then you will have to pay 10 times of handling fee not to mentioned the minimal amount charged by JAC. :)

The problem is that many times, Amazon will send the DVD's in several batches, especially if they will come from different warehouses. If they don't all arrive on the same day, JAC may ship the DVD's in several batches as well.

The only way I can think of to avoid that is to use 2-day shipping or become an Amazon Prime member so that you get free 2-day shipping. Or just pray.  :)
